A Certificate Programme in Cultural Sensitivity in Emergency Response equips participants with the crucial skills to navigate diverse cultural contexts during crisis situations. This program emphasizes practical application and real-world scenarios, making graduates highly sought after in humanitarian aid and disaster relief organizations.
Learning outcomes include enhanced cross-cultural communication skills, improved understanding of cultural values and beliefs impacting emergency response, and the ability to develop culturally appropriate strategies for effective intervention. Participants will learn to identify and address potential biases within emergency response frameworks, promoting inclusivity and equitable service delivery.
The programme's duration typically ranges from a few weeks to several months, depending on the institution and intensity of the course. The flexible delivery options often include online modules, blended learning, and in-person workshops, catering to varied professional schedules and learning preferences. Successful completion leads to a recognized certificate, boosting career prospects and demonstrating a commitment to culturally sensitive practices.
